Mission: Jefferson Academy of Music, an original member of the Metropolitan Learning Community in Columbus, was founded in 1979. The name honors Thomas Jefferson, one of the nation's earliest devotees of the arts, and himself a violinist. It was established for these four purposes: 1. To search out and foster the deveopment of superior talent in the playing of a musical instrument. 2. To establish a center of excellence in teaching of string and piano music. 3. To act as a community educational resource for talented individuals or groups, both professional and amateur, who wish to upgrade their performance capabilities; and 4. To make available to the community the experience and talent of outstanding professional musicians within an educational framework.
